Sustainability is no longer a buzzword but an essential component for companies intending to flourish in the modern-day economy. Companies are significantly realising that embracing eco-friendly practices isn't practically following trends; it's about protecting long-term growth and strength. Whether you run a small business or manage an international corporation, embedding sustainability into your operations can enhance your credibility, drive development, and ensure long-term success.

In today's competitive landscape, customers and stakeholders alike are placing enormous worth on sustainability. More people are selecting to support services that show a genuine commitment to ecological duty, social ethics, and corporate governance. By becoming more sustainable, business can separate themselves in the market, building stronger customer loyalty and trust. Not just does this aid bring in ethically conscious customers, but it also promotes a sense of function within the labor force, which can boost employee satisfaction and retention. Furthermore, services with sustainable operations are much better geared up to adjust to the progressing guidelines and policies created to alleviate environment modification.

The effect of sustainability on a business's bottom line surpasses consumer fulfillment. Sustainable practices typically cause functional performance and expense savings. For example, purchasing renewable resource, minimizing waste, and optimising resource usage can considerably cut operational costs. Energy-efficient buildings, responsible sourcing of products, and a concentrate on minimizing carbon footprints assist improve processes and minimise waste. These procedures not just minimize environmental harm however likewise make services more durable to economic variations, such as increasing fuel or energy costs. Additionally, sustainability motivates development, as companies need to believe creatively to solve ecological obstacles, which can result in the development of brand-new products, services, and business models.

Business obligation is increasingly connected to sustainability, and this connection is becoming a critical consider drawing in investors. Financiers are now more likely to support businesses with a strong sustainability program, recognising that such business are better placed for long-term success. Firms that prioritise ecological, social, and governance (ESG) criteria are viewed as lower-risk investments, using a stable return with time. Furthermore, sustainability reporting is becoming a compulsory requirement in different nations, and companies that stop working to comply may deal with financial penalties or lose financier confidence. In this regard, embracing sustainable business practices is not only about principles but also about securing financial practicality.
